Hurricane Azure is sweeping toward Ocean of Stars at a breakneck pace and has spared no expense in its fury. The small island, only just beginning to fully recuperate with the effects of the earthquake to devastate it three years prior, is about to suffer yet another natural disaster that threatens to bring the islanders to their knees.<br>
<br>
The rain began early Tuesday morning. It brought with it wind of epic proportions, only hinting at the true fury only a day behind it. And then, that Tuesday night, there was the strange eerie feeling of everything being absolutely still and silent, as if this hurricane was merely folklore made up by people wanting to drive back toward a faith in the Harvest Goddess. It was the stubborn people, however, that insisted it was but the calm before the storm.<br>
<br>
They were right.<br>
<br>
As Wednesday‘s sun rose, bringing with it more rain and wind than could be imagined, the Mayor finished his preparations: his entire mansion was opened for any and all refugees who sought shelter during the hurricane, equipped fully with food, water, beds, first aid kits, and medical staff to help all who came. The windows were boarded down, sandbags were dragged in to stop any bizarre floodwater that managed to stay at the top of the giant hill, and entertainment was even provided in the form of his extensive personal library. If anyone approaches, no questions are asked. They are merely welcomed in, given their beginning rations, and gestured to a bed with a few brief instructions.<br>
<br>
For the next five hours, the storm built in intensity, until it was shaking any poorly constructed house and sending leaves and flowers flying through the air in strange miniature cyclones. It was when the clock ticked over to 11am, however, that Hurricane Azure truly and mercilessly struck.<br>
<br>
Tree limbs begin to snap and fly through the air. Unattended animals are picked up and swirled away. Sunstone Beachway‘s houses are completely destroyed in a matter of minutes. Before an hour has passed, strong flooding will course through every low area, especially ones near a water supply, and leave half of the island looking as if it should be underwater in the first place.<br>
<br>
Let the panic begin.<br>
